Output bde26831b967b8ce1b5df36ca4815e7d2c574d0f840073aff8a96c03b277adf8:1

value
28885336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deab177bbda27f515c5e0530e7a2405c7a4fabbe OP_EQUAL
address
MUCXCgJehabWBGAg23Sczus8wUdEC8zdEm
transaction
bde26831b967b8ce1b5df36ca4815e7d2c574d0f840073aff8a96c03b277adf8
spent
true